The hexadecimal value (hex value) of this color is #d4acdd. In RGB, it consists of 83.1% Red, 67.5% Green, and 86.7% Blue. Likewise, in the CMYK color space, it consists of 4.1% Cyan, 22.2% Magenta, 0% Yellow, and 13.3% Black. On the color wheel, its Hue is found at 289.0°, with saturation of 41.9% and lightness of 77.1%. The decimal value for #d4acdd is 13937885, and its nearest "web safe" color is #cc99cc. In the RGB color space, the strongest component for #d4acdd is blue. In the CMYK color space, its strongest component is magenta. And in the RYB color space, its strongest component is blue.

Analogous Colors of #d4acdd

Analogous colors are located 30 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el. For #d4acdd — which has hue 289.0° — its analogous colors are located at 259.0° and 319.0°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#d4acdd.

Triadic Colors of #d4acdd

Triadic colors are located 120 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el, which means the original color and its triadic colors are equidistant from one another on the color wheel and form a triangle. For #d4acdd — which has hue 289.0° — its triadic colors are located at 49.0° and 289.0°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#d4acdd.

Complementary Color of #d4acdd

A complementary color is located opposite a color on the color wheel (180 degrees away). For #d4acdd — which has hue 289.0° — its complementary color is located at 109.0°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#d4acdd.

Accessibility

Not Accessibility Recommended

We analyzed whether #d4acdd is an accessible color when used as a text / foreground color against a white background. This analysis is based on the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2 Level issued by W3C. Based on this analysis, we calculate a contrast ratio against white of approximately 2.0:1 against white. Under both the AA and AAA level standards, this is not a high enough ratio to be considered accessible for either normal size or large text.
